Hardware Hardware refers to the computer's
tangible components or delivery
systems that store and run the
written instructions provided by the
. software.
Examples of hardware
Examples of hardware in a computer are
the Processor, Memory Devices,
Monitor, Printer, Keyboard, Mouse, and
the Central Processing Unit.
Software The software is the intangible part of
the device that lets the user interact
with the hardware and command it to
perform specific tasks.
Types of software
● system software
● utility software
● application software.

Search A search engine is a software system
designed to carry out web searches.
They search the World Wide Web in a

engines systematic way for particular


information specified in a textual web
search query. The search results are
generally presented in a line of results,
often referred to as search engine
results pages.
Example of search engines
● Google
● Yahoo
● Bing
● Baidu
● DuckDuckGo

VoIP services convert your voice into a

Voip digital signal that travels over the


Internet. If you are calling a regular
phone number, the signal is converted
to a regular telephone signal before it
reaches the destination.
Examples of voip
● Nextiva.
● Aircall.
● Zoiper.
● Skype.
● WhatsApp.
● Google Hangouts.
● Viber.
● Facebook Messenger.

File transfer protocol (FTP) is a way to
download, upload, and transfer files
ftp from one location to another on the
Internet and between computer
(upload/download) systems. FTP enables the transfer of
files back and forth between computers
or through the cloud. Users require an
Internet connection in order to execute
FTP transfers
Examples of ftp
● FTP
● FTPS
● SFTP
● SCP.
● HTTP & HTTPS
● AS2, AS3, & AS4.

Email distribution lists, also known as

Mailing List mailing lists, listservs or discussion


lists, allow people with common
interests to easily share information
and participate in discussions by using
a dedicated email address. Messages
.
sent to the list address are
automatically distributed to all
members of the group.
